Glukhovsky remains coy on Metro 2033 follow-up

Metro 2033 2

Metro 2033 author Dmitry Glukhovsky has remained mum on a possible follow-up with Metro 2034.

Speaking with VG247 at an event for the title in London last week, Glukhovsky, asked if a Metro 2034 game was in the works as well as writing on Metro 2035, said:

"We can’t answer that. It’s THQ’s secret. But hopefully this is going to be the start of a big franchise.

"We all hope it will flourish and prosper. I’m using it as an opportunity to expand this world and turn it into a real universe."

Right now, Metro 2033 will release on March 19 in the UK for 360 and PC. There's no PS3 version coming because of a "business decision" made by THQ.

However, the publisher insists that if you are getting it for either platform, there'll be enough there to keep everyone interested, including those into multiplayer.
